SOLVED: SwiftUI + CoreData -- seed data for app

Hi all,

I have some data that I want to pre-populate for all users of my app' the idea being that you may or may not want to add to this dataset in the app, but for many users the defaults will be enough.

When I develop in C# and EF; there is a method to do this within a migration. Is there an equivalent approach for Swift/UI and CoreData?

I don't know about C#'s migration. But it's no problem to check für the record count on start of the app and if it is zero add default data.
